A typical Flamengo lineup may feature a 4-3-3 formation, but the coach can change this depending on the opponent. This formation is all about attacking, with a solid defensive line and a midfield that needs to control possession and support the attack. The goalkeeper is the last line of defense, so the team will often rely on the goalkeeper to be an experienced player who can read the game well. The defense includes two central defenders and two full-backs. The job of the defense is to stop the opposing team from scoring. The midfield includes defensive midfielders, central midfielders, and attacking midfielders. The midfield’s job is to win the ball, keep possession, and distribute the ball to the forwards. The forwards consist of wingers and a center-forward. These are the players that need to score goals.

Each position has specific roles and responsibilities. The goalkeeper must be an excellent shot-stopper, a good communicator, and able to command the penalty area. The defenders need to be solid, with the center-backs being physically strong and good in the air and the full-backs offering attacking width. The midfielders must be able to win the ball, pass effectively, and support both the defense and the attack. The forwards have to be clinical in front of the goal and create scoring opportunities. The coach will analyze the strengths and weaknesses of the opposing team to determine which players best fit their game plan. This could mean adjusting the formation, selecting players based on their pace, skill, or aerial ability. Players’ form will also have a major impact on their selection in the lineup. If a player is performing well in training or in previous matches, he’s more likely to be selected. Injuries and suspensions are also essential factors in determining the lineup. They can force the coach to make changes and adapt his strategy.

Potential Formations and Tactical Approaches

Now, let's explore the potential formations and tactical approaches that Flamengo might adopt. Football formations aren't just about putting players on the field; they dictate how the team will attack, defend, and control the game. Flamengo often employs flexible formations that allow them to adapt to different opponents. The team may use a 4-3-3, which emphasizes a strong attacking trio and a midfield that needs to provide both defensive cover and support. The 4-2-3-1 is another popular formation, which features a solid defensive base, creative midfielders, and an attacking midfielder supporting the lone striker. The coach will base the strategy on the opponent’s strengths and weaknesses.

The tactical approaches vary based on the match. Flamengo might prioritize possession and control, trying to dominate the midfield and create space for attackers. Counter-attacking is another approach, where the team sits back, absorbs pressure, and then launches quick attacks. Set pieces can also be a key tactical element, with the team practicing corner kicks and free kicks. Flamengo’s tactical approach is not fixed; the coach adapts the strategy based on the rival and the team's current condition. The team will change their tactics during a game. The ability to adapt and change strategies is crucial for success. These strategic decisions are aimed at exploiting the opponent’s weaknesses and maximizing their own strengths. The coach analyzes the team's performance and makes adjustments as the match progresses.
